Output a9667117afc381a22afa6e317ed4bb6c413e5ecbdce82acfd843c684ed69f6be:3

value
42523617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97f064f5e7e79535e02d4ac3ac175b860febe8c0 OP_EQUAL
address
MMkYFHpH3aE2RWNdPuBVSsjboQMs9h6hkT
transaction
a9667117afc381a22afa6e317ed4bb6c413e5ecbdce82acfd843c684ed69f6be
spent
true